Mom-to-Be Darlene Haynes Found Dead, Fetus Missing

Missing FetusA 23-year-old Worcester, Massachusetts woman, Darlene Haynes, was found mutilated, wrapped in bedding and stuffed in a closet in her apartment after not being heard from for days.

Who Did It?

So, is this is a case of “stealing” a baby for monetary or other purposes, or an act of horrific violence purely for the sake of violence?
Police have not named any suspects, but two men are currently “under review” for being in connection with Haynes. One, ex-boyfriend Roberto Rodriquez, was the father of one of Haynes’s one-year-old daughter, Christina. Apparently Haynes had taken out a restraining order on Rodriquez almost four weeks ago after he made threats . . . including death threats.
The other man in question is landlord William Thompson, who also conveniently discovered her body. Sources say Thompson would enter Haynes’s apartment un-invited, and reportedly “harass” her repeatedly.
So far, neither of these two men has officially been named a suspect in the case, and police are unclear as to the motive for the killing and kidnapping.

Who is Darlene Haynes?

Family members report that Darlene Haynes was severely developmentally disabled, functioning as a 12- or 13-year-old. In fact, Hayne’s great-aunt, Sanrda Grandmaison told reporters that “Darlene does not have the know-how or the ability to sense danger.”Despite those limitations, she was mother to three other children Jasmine, 5, and Lilli, 3 (who were being raised by Haynes’ grandmother), and Christina, 1.
Grandmaison also attested that Haynes was a good mother who loved her children unconditionally and was looking forward to the birth of her fourth little girl.
